PER CURIAM.

This case involves the Medical Liability and Insurance Improvement Act's ("the Act") expert-report requirements. See Tex.Rev.Civ. Stat. art. 4590i, § 13.01. The trial court dismissed the plaintiffs' medical malpractice claims after it determined that their expert report did not satisfy the Act's requirements.
